About the Role

As a Client Care Coordinator at a shelter for families with children, you will help families in crisis by providing support for mental health, domestic violence, and substance abuse. You will also work with children who have experienced trauma and may have special needs, and help strengthen each family's resilience. This role involves completing psychosocial assessments and participating in a multidisciplinary team approach to ensure positive outcomes for families, while also providing supervised clinical hours for career advancement.

Responsibilities

  • Help families in crisis with mental health, domestic violence, and substance abuse counseling.
  • Work with children who have experienced trauma and may have other special needs.
  • Fortify the strengths of each family.
  • Complete psychosocial assessments.
  • Participate in a multidisciplinary team approach to service delivery.

Requirements

  • Current LMSW or LMHC license.
  • Compassion and respect for parents and children experiencing homelessness.
  • Knowledge of child and adolescent development, emotional/behavioral health, mental health, parent-child relationship family dynamics, and diagnostic classification.
  • Bilingual (English/Spanish) is helpful but not required.

About the Company

  • HELP USA is one of the nation's largest non-profit homeless services providers and low-income housing developers.
  • We serve at-risk populations including families, individuals, veterans, survivors of domestic violence, people with physical and mental health challenges and disabilities, and seniors.
  • We have an annual operating budget approaching $150 million and 1400 employees working in nearly 60 programs.
  • We have helped over 500,000 people facing homelessness and poverty to build better lives.
